一、目标与概述
本文首先说明如何在TP(TokenPocket)钱包中添加并管理多个“YES”钱包账号(理解为同类代币或同名链上账户),随后从区块链技术、网络通信安全、缓冲区溢出防护、数字金融变革、合约语言与资产增值策略等角度做深入技术与实践分析,给出操作与安全建议。
二、在TP钱包中添加多个YES钱包的步骤(实操要点)
1. 明确“YES钱包”含义:是同一助记词下的多个派生地址(HD钱包),还是不同私钥/助记词产生的独立钱包;两者管理方式不同。
2. 创建或导入钱包:打开TP,选择“创建钱包”或“导入钱包”。导入时可使用助记词(BIP39)、私钥或Keystore文件。为不同YES账户可重复导入不同助记词或私钥。
3. 使用HD派生:若要在同一助记词下生成多个地址,可在导入时修改派生路径(BIP44、BIP49、BIP84等)或在钱包“账户管理/添加子账户”功能中创建新地址。注意不同链(以太坊、BSC、HECO等)使用不同派生路径。
4. 添加自定义代币YES:在相应链上打开“添加代币”,填写YES合约地址、代币符号、精度,确保合约地址来自官方或可信源并校验Etherscan/区块浏览器信息。
5. 多账户切换与标签管理:给每个账号命名、设置标签,便于区分。开启指纹/FaceID与密码保护。
6. 连接dApp或硬件钱包:使用WalletConnect或硬件签名器(如Ledger)连接时,注意只在官方/信任的dApp打开权限,校验交易详情。
7. 备份与恢复:为每个独立钱包备份助记词与Keystore,离线保存并分层加密,测试恢复流程。
三、区块链技术要点
- HD钱包与派生路径:BIP39助记词+BIP32/BIP44派生可从单一种子生成多地址,便于管理多个YES地址而不泄露额外私钥。理解路径与链兼容性至关重要。
- 跨链与桥接:若YES存在于多个链,使用可信桥或跨链协议迁移资产时需注意批准权限与合约审计情况。
四、安全网络通信
- RPC/TLS:钱包与节点交互应使用HTTPS或wss,证书校验与证书钉扎(pinning)减少中间人攻击风险。
- JSON-RPC安全:限制来源、使用速率限制与签名校验,避免重放攻击与非授权请求。
- 隐私与元数据:避免在非信任网络泄露关联账号的敏感元数据,使用远程签名或隔离客户端显示最小信息。
五、防缓冲区溢出与客户端安全
- 使用内存安全语言或安全库(例如Rust或高质量的C++安全实践),对输入长度进行边界检查。
- 在解析交易/ABI/JSON时使用经充分测试和模糊测试(fuzzing)的解析器,加入沙箱机制,降低解析器被利用风险。
- 部署常见缓解措施:ASLR、DEP、栈保护(stack canaries)、代码审计与自动化静态分析(SAST)。
六、数字金融变革与钱包的角色

- 钱包从简单签名工具演进为DeFi门户,支持借贷、质押、链上治理与NFT管理。多地址管理能提高资产配置灵活性。
- 身份与合规:钱包可以承载去中心化身份(DID),实现合规审查与隐私保护的平衡。
七、合约语言与安全设计
- 常见语言:Solidity(以太系)、Vyper、Rust(Solana/Substrate)、Move等。不同语言有不同安全模型与工具链。
- 工具与规范:静态分析(Slither)、动态分析(MythX、Echidna)、形式化验证(Certora、K-framework)有助于降低合约漏洞风险。
八、资产增值策略与风险管理
- 被动增值:质押、节点委托、流动性挖矿(注意合约风险与永续池机制)。

- 主动策略:套利、借贷对冲、跨链机会。始终评估流动性、手续费、税务与智能合约审计情况。
- 风险控制:资产分散、设置权限最小化的approve限额、定期撤回过期/不必要的合约授权。
九、总结与安全检查清单
- 操作要点:明确是多助记词还是多派生地址、正确使用派生路径、验证合约地址、备份助记词并测试恢复。
- 安全清单:HTTPS/wss、证书钉扎、硬件签名优先、模糊测试与解析器安全、最小化授权、开启多重验证。
附:简要故障排查
- 看不到某个YES代币:检查网络链ID、代币合约地址与精度;尝试手动添加代币;换用可信节点查询。
- 导入失败:核对助记词拼写、空格与派生路径;尝试不同导入方式(私钥/Keystore)。
评论
CryptoFan92
写得很全面,尤其是对HD派生路径和合约地址校验的提醒很实用。
小龙
按着步骤操作成功添加多个地址了,备份和恢复测试真的不能省。
Alice
关于缓冲区溢出那部分讲得好,建议钱包开发者多用Rust等内存安全语言。
链圈老王
补充一点:使用硬件钱包签名时要确认浏览器插件不是恶意的。
Neo
对资产增值和风险管理的建议很接地气,尤其是approve限额那条非常必要。